WebJul 18, 2024 · Spurling test, which compresses the foramina, is useful in diagnosing likely radiculopathy. With the head extended, the head should then be rotated. The test is positive if the pain radiates down the upper limb of the ipsilateral side of the rotation. In some cases, cervical traction can provide relief of radicular pain. WebRadiculopathy refers to symptoms that develop when there is compression of a spinal nerve root. Most commonly, the nerve compression is related to a disc herniation or spondylosis (degenerative changes in the spine) and may occur with or without trauma. It is important to note that not all disc herniations cause nerve compression or pain. WebRadiculopathy is the term used to describe pinching of the nerve roots as they exit the spinal cord or cross the intervertebral disc, rather than the compression of the cord itself (myelopathy). These treatments can include the use of back supports, medication, physical therapy, steroid ... dibenzyltoluol wasserstoffWebThe most important elements in the evaluation of lumbar radiculopathy are the history and physical examination. Diagnostic testing takes two forms: one to corroborate the diagnosis and the second to determine the etiology.
